1️⃣ No Clear Value Proposition
❌ The Problem
Visitors don’t instantly understand:
What you do
Who you help
Why they should choose you
If users cannot comprehend your message they will exit your site within multiple seconds.

✅ The Fix
Your homepage should have a direct headline which shows your main message
You should explain advantages that customers will receive instead of displaying your offered services
You should answer this question within 5 seconds by explaining how this benefit will help your audience.
📌 Example:
Small Businesses can generate leads through our effective digital marketing solutions
2️⃣ Weak or Missing Call-to-Action (CTA)
❌ The Problem
Your site presents an attractive design however users remain unsure about their upcoming actions.

✅ The Fix
You should implement powerful CTAs which include:
Get a Free Consultation
Request a Quote
Book a Free Strategy Call
You should position CTAs:
Above the fold
After every important section
On service pages and blogs
3️⃣ Slow Website Loading Speed
❌ The Problem
A slow website leads to user dissatisfaction which results in more people leaving the site. A delay of 1 to 2 seconds will severely impact your conversion rate.
The solution requires the following actions:
Compress images
Use fast hosting
Enable caching
Optimize mobile speed

💡 Tip: Google favors fast websites in rankings too.
4️⃣ Poor Mobile Experience
❌ The Problem
Mobile devices serve as the primary method for most users to access websites. Your site will experience lower conversion rates when it fails to provide mobile-friendly access.
The solution requires the following actions:
Use responsive design
Make buttons easy to tap
Keep forms short and readable
You should avoid using popups which block users from accessing website content

6️⃣ Lack of Trust Signals
❌ The Problem
Visitors refuse to provide their information because they lack trust in your brand.
The solution requires the following actions:
You should add trust elements which include:
Client testimonials
Google reviews
Certifications
Case studies
Clear contact details
Trust elements will decrease user doubts which helps to increase your conversion rate.
